Doesnt change the fact that PTC is better tech than resistive based tech. But to each his own.

Also you dont seem to understand how PTC components actually work.
Here is a resistance vs temperature graph that explains PTC's in general

1721731714334.png
This kind of breaks down your argument that PTC will take far longer to heat up water under a certain temperature.
Quite the opposite. Under a certain temp the internal resistance stays fairly low , in other words allowing a higher amount of current to heat which is fairly stable until a temperature reference point is met , after which the internal resistance increases lower the power consumed.
A far safer tech all round compared to resistive heating.
